Bhubaneswar: Ahead of its theatrical release on June 12, the team of Bharat Bhagya Vidhata is travelling across the country to honour the real heroes who quietly hold India together during moments of crisis.

As part of a nationwide initiative, the makers have begun hosting special screenings in various cities, inviting often-overlooked frontline workers—nurses, ward boys, hospital watchmen, cleaners, security staff, and support personnel—whose tireless service rarely makes headlines, yet whose contributions keep the nation functioning.

The campaign arrived in Bhubaneswar with a special screening dedicated to healthcare professionals. The event was attended by actor and Member of Parliament Kangana Ranaut and Odisha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i.

In a heartfelt and symbolic gesture, select healthcare workers were felicitated with Bharat Bhagya Vidhata badges, personally presented by Kangana Ranaut and the Chief Minister. The honour recognized them as the true “Bharat Bhagya Vidhata” — the architects of the nation’s destiny.

Following Bhubaneswar, the film’s tribute tour will continue to Raipur before heading to Jodhpur, Delhi, and Jaipur, carrying forward its message of gratitude, recognition, and remembrance.

Set largely within the confines of a hospital, Bharat Bhagya Vidhata presents a stirring contrast between chaos unfolding outside and courage standing firm within. As fear grips the city, it is the hospital staff—nurses, ward boys, cleaners, security personnel, lift operators, and administrators—who refuse to abandon their posts.

Inspired by real-life incidents, the film reinforces a powerful truth: without these invisible pillars, the system would collapse within a single day.

Kangana Ranaut essays the role of a staff nurse—an ordinary woman whose commitment often goes unnoticed. At home, she is overlooked; at work, she is frequently underestimated. Yet when terror strikes, it is her courage, resilience, and moral clarity that become a lifeline for hundreds.

Alongside Kangana Ranaut, Bharat Bhagya Vidhata features an ensemble cast including Girija Oak, Smita Tambe, Amrutha Namdev, Esha Dey, Priya Berde, Asha Shelar, Suhita Thatte, Rasika Agashe, Aditya Mishra, and Zahid Khan.

Presented by Dr. Jayantilal Gada (PEN Studios), the film is produced by PEN Studios, Manikarnika Films, and Paramhans Creations in association with Eunoia Films LLP and Floating Rocks Entertainment Pvt. Ltd. The film will be distributed by Pen Marudhar and is scheduled for theatrical release on June 12, 2026.
